Patent number: 12540586Abstract: A fuel supply device for a four-cycle internal combustion engine using hydrogen as fuel and including cylinders, comprising: an intake passage including a branch portion branching from an upstream side toward a downstream side so as to correspond to the number of cylinders, a single pipe portion on an upstream side of the branch portion, and intake port portions on a downstream side of the branch portion; and a plurality of first fuel injection valves provided in each of the intake port portions, wherein a maximum injection period of the first fuel injection valve is corresponding to an opening period of an intake valve of the internal combustion engine, a second fuel injection valve is provided in the single pipe portion or the branch portion, and a minimum injection quantity of the second fuel injection valve is smaller than a minimum injection quantity of the first fuel injection valve.Type: GrantFiled: July 16, 2024Date of Patent: February 3, 2026Assignee: KABUSHIKI KAISHA TOYOTA JIDOSHOKKIInventor: Hiroki Kambe

Patent number: 11136043Abstract: A yaw moment control apparatus for a vehicle which comprises a rear wheel driving torque transmission path that transmits the driving torque of a drive unit to left and right rear wheels, the path including a speed increasing device for increasing speed of the rear wheels relative to the front wheels, and clutches that change transmission capacities of driving torques to the left and right rear wheels, and a control unit for controlling fastening forces of the clutches. The control unit controls the fastening forces based on a lateral acceleration of the vehicle to impart a yaw moment by a driving torque difference between the wheels to the vehicle when traveling control of the vehicle by applying braking forces to the wheels is not being performed, and to impart no yaw moment by a driving torque difference to the vehicle when traveling control of the vehicle is being performed.Type: GrantFiled: March 8, 2019Date of Patent: October 5, 2021Assignee: TOYOTA JIDOSHA KABUSHIKI KAISHAInventors: Hiroki Kambe, Yusuke Suetake

Patent number: 10384674Abstract: A vehicle turning control device mounted on a vehicle includes a control device that calculates a control yaw moment for increasing turning performance of the vehicle and uses a yaw moment generation device to generate the control yaw moment. A limit control yaw moment, which is an upper limit of an allowable range of the control yaw moment in which the vehicle does not spin, is a function of a lateral jerk equivalent and decreases as the lateral jerk equivalent increases. The control device calculates the limit control yaw moment based on the lateral jerk equivalent and the function, updates a hold control yaw moment with a latest value of the limit control yaw moment when the latest value is less than the hold control yaw moment, and determines the control yaw moment so as not to exceed the hold control yaw moment.Type: GrantFiled: December 18, 2017Date of Patent: August 20, 2019Assignee: TOYOTA JIDOSHA KABUSHIKI KAISHAInventor: Hiroki Kambe

Patent number: 8818633Abstract: There is provided a steering apparatus that includes a steering member that is provided in a vehicle and that is capable of being turned so as to steer the vehicle; and a determination device configured to determine that a kickback state is present if an operation point determined according to the steering angle of the steering member and the steering torque that acts on the steering member is outside a criterion region that is determined beforehand. The steering apparatus and the kickback determination device are able to properly cope with the kickback.Type: GrantFiled: September 15, 2011Date of Patent: August 26, 2014Assignee: Toyota Jidosha Kabushiki KaishaInventors: Yuji Ebihara, Hiroki Kambe
